Darling Harbour Proposed Timetable
Changes are proposed to the ferry timetable to make the best possible match of services with customer needs.
The main changes proposed to Darling Harbour services are:-
Darling Harbour services would stop at Darling Harbour (King Street Wharf 3) instead of Darling Harbour (Aquarium Wharf)*. King Street Wharf 3 would be gated and Ticket Vending Machines installed to make to make it easier for passenger to purchase tickets.
-
Increased frequencies in the AM and PM peak periods. This change is designed to improve access to growing centres of employment on the western side of Sydney CBD and Pyrmont Bay for commuters travelling from Balmain East (Darling Street), McMahons Point and Milsons Point.
-
Extended hours of operation on Saturday nights.
-
Increased service frequencies on Saturdays and Sundays to meet increased passenger demand.
*Aquarium Wharf will remain fully operational for use when passenger numbers exceed capacity on King Street Wharf 3.
